Communication base station grid-connected power photovoltaic power generation solution
The communication base station installs solar panels outdoors, and adds MPPT solar controllers and other equipment in the computer room. The power generated by solar energy is used by the DC load of the base station computer room, and the insufficient power is supplemented by energy storage devices. [pdf]

Where is a large-scale PV distribution network located in Tunisia?
The distribution network located in the state of Hammam-Lif which is in the north of Tunisia near the Mediterranean coast, having a PV penetration of 12 MW was studied. A large-scale PV penetration including STATCOM is connected to the power system as shown in Fig. 5 respectively to buses 13, 18 and 46.
Does a network-related fault affect photovoltaic system integration in Tunisia?
Network- related faults like outage of photovoltaic farm event, three-phase short-circuit at a conventional bus, and voltage dip at the largest photovoltaic station have been considered. It is hoped that the results of the presented study would benefit Tunisian’s utility’s policies on integration of PV systems.

Does Kazakhstan have a plan for electric power development?
The Government of Kazakhstan has developed an action plan for electric power development through 2030, which includes a list of proposed power plants for modernization or reconstruction as well as the construction of new facilities.
What is a power grid in Kazakhstan?
Electricity Transmission Sector Power grids of the Republic of Kazakhstan are a set of substations, switchgears and interconnecting transmission lines of 0.4-1150 kV, designed for transmission and (or) distribution of electric energy.

How much electricity is generated in Kazakhstan?
In 2021, 114.3 billion kWh of electricity was generated at the country’s power plants. Kazakhstan’s national grid is operated by Kazakhstan’s Electricity Grid Operating Company (KEGOC), a state-owned company responsible for electricity transmission and distribution network management.
